Understanding what Psalms 19:4 really means
In Psalms 19:4, we encounter a verse that beautifully captures the universal reach of God’s creation and His glory. This verse is nestled within Psalm 19, a poetic composition attributed to David, which exalts God’s creation and His law. “Their voice goes out into all the earth” signifies that the evidence of God’s handiwork is not confined to a specific location but permeates the entire world, speaking to all people regardless of their geographical boundaries. It paints a picture of creation as a grand symphony declaring the majesty of its Creator.
Furthermore, the phrase “Their words to the ends of the world” emphasizes the omnipresence of God’s message through His creation. It suggests that the natural world serves as a universal language through which God communicates His greatness and wisdom to all humanity. This imagery underscores the idea that God’s revelation is not limited to written words but is vividly displayed in the intricate tapestry of the natural world.
In Romans 1:20, we find a complementary verse that elucidates the concept presented in Psalms 19:4. It explains that God’s invisible qualities are clearly perceived in creation, leaving humanity without excuse for not acknowledging His existence and power. Similarly, Psalm 97:6 echoes the sentiment of creation proclaiming God’s righteousness, reinforcing the notion that the heavens themselves declare the glory of God.
